Baler (BQA) to Hyderabad (HYD) Flight Distance

The flight distance from Dr.Juan C. Angara Airport (BQA) in Baler, Philippines to Rajiv Gandhi International Airport Shamshabad (HYD) in Hyderabad, India is 4,586 kilometers (2,850 miles / 2,476 nautical miles). The estimated flight time for this route is approximately 6h, flying west at a heading of 278°.

This is a long-haul route typically operated by wide-body aircraft such as the Boeing 777 or Airbus A350. Full meal service, in-flight entertainment, and comfort amenities are standard.

This is an international route connecting Philippines with India. Travelers should check visa requirements, customs regulations, and any travel advisories before booking.

Time zone information: When it's 06:38 in Baler, it's 04:08 in Hyderabad.

There is a significant elevation difference of 1,916 feet between the two airports. Rajiv Gandhi International Airport Shamshabad sits higher than Dr.Juan C. Angara Airport.

The return flight from Hyderabad (HYD) to Baler (BQA) follows a heading of 86° (east). Actual flight times may vary depending on wind conditions, air traffic, and the specific aircraft used.
